- Как безопасно и эффективно перенести базу данных Битрикс на другой сервер
- Как правильно перенести базу Битрикса на другой сервер?
- Создание бэкапа базы данных
- Что такое бэкап базы данных?
- Как создать бэкап базы данных в Битриксе?
- Где хранить бэкапы базы данных?
- Установка Bitrix Virtual Appliance на новый сервер
- Шаг 1: Подготовка сервера
- Шаг 2: Загрузка и установка Bitrix Virtual Appliance
- Шаг 3: Настройка Bitrix Virtual Appliance
- Копирование бэкапа на новый сервер
- Восстановление базы данных на новом сервере
- Шаг 1: Создание новой базы данных на сервере
- Шаг 2: Создание резервной копии базы данных на старом сервере
- Шаг 3: Перенос базы данных на новый сервер
- Шаг 4: Перенастройка подключения к базе данных
- Проверка работоспособности перенесенной БД
- Вопрос-ответ:
- Какой способ переноса базы данных Битрикса является наиболее безопасным?
- Можно ли перенести базу данных Битрикса на другой сервер с помощью программного обеспечения?
- Можно ли перенести базу данных Битрикса в облако?
- Какие параметры сервера нужно учитывать при переносе базы данных Битрикса?
- Можно ли перенести только определенные таблицы из базы данных Битрикса?
Как безопасно и эффективно перенести базу данных Битрикс на другой сервер
Перенос базы данных в Битрикс является необходимой операцией при миграции сайта на другой хостинг-провайдер или изменении типа сервера. Она также может быть необходима, когда вы обновляете версию CMS или выполняете другие технические работы.
Перенос базы данных может быть сложной процедурой, требующей хорошего технического понимания, правильных инструментов и подготовки. Несоблюдение правил и рекомендаций может привести к потере данных и проблемам с функциональностью вашего сайта, поэтому важно следовать инструкциям внимательно и обратиться к профессионалам, если вам нужна помощь.
Эта статья дает пошаговую инструкцию о том, как перенести базу данных в Битрикс без ошибок и проблем. Мы рассмотрим все шаги, начиная с подготовки и заканчивая контролем качества, чтобы вы могли выполнить эту операцию без проблем и с минимальным риском для вашего сайта.
Как правильно перенести базу Битрикса на другой сервер?
Перенос базы данных на другой сервер может вызвать некоторые проблемы, если не будет выполнено несколько важных шагов. Во-первых, необходимо создать резервную копию всех файлов и базы данных с текущего сервера. Во-вторых, необходимо убедиться, что новый сервер обладает аналогичной версией базы данных и всех необходимых инструментов.
Далее необходимо загрузить резервные копии на новый сервер и установить новую версию Битрикса. Затем нужно создать новую базу данных и импортировать резервные копии на новый сервер. Не забудьте изменить настройки базы данных в файле настроек сайта.
После настройки нового сервера необходимо проверить новую версию сайта. Если возникнут некоторые ошибки, при выполнении действий, необходимо проверить настройки PHP, чтобы убедиться, что все рекомендуемые параметры PHP установлены на новом сервере.
Окончательный шаг заключается в проверке всего сайта и его функциональности. В случае возникновения каких-либо ошибок, необходимо вернуться на предыдущий шаг и повторить все действия с резервными копиями, чтобы избежать потери ценной информации.
В общем, перенос базы данных на другой сервер может быть немного затруднительным, но если следовать рекомендуемым шагам, все действия будут выполнены без проблем.
Создание бэкапа базы данных
Что такое бэкап базы данных?
Бэкап базы данных – это копия всех данных, хранящихся в системе управления базами данных (СУБД), которая позволяет восстановить их в случае потери или повреждения основной базы. Создание регулярных бэкапов базы данных является одним из важнейших элементов безопасности информации.
Как создать бэкап базы данных в Битриксе?
Создание бэкапа базы данных в Битриксе може быть выполнено несколькими способами:
- С помощью Бэкапа и восстановления из административной панели CMS Битрикс. Данный способ позволяет создать полный бэкап системы, включая файловую структуру и базу данных.
- С помощью консольной команды mysqldump. Этот способ позволит создать бэкап только базы данных, что ускорит и упростит процедуру создания бэкапа.
Где хранить бэкапы базы данных?
Для безопасности, рекомендуется хранить бэкапы базы данных на отдельном сервере или в облачном хранилище. Также, необходимо обеспечить защиту бэкап-копий от несанкционированного доступа и установить регулярные проверки и тестирование возможности восстановления данных из бэкапа.
Преимущества | Недостатки |
---|---|
Удобство создания и восстановления данных в случае ошибки или сбоя в работе основной базы. | Занимает время и место на сервере. |
Позволяет в значительной степени снизить риски обязательств по безопасности информации. | Не защищает от утечки данных при несанкционированном доступе к бэкап-копии. |
Обеспечивает возможность переноса данных на другой сервер или хостинг-провайдер, не потеряв все имеющуюся информацию. | Требует знаний и времени на создание и восстановление бэкапа. |
Установка Bitrix Virtual Appliance на новый сервер
Шаг 1: Подготовка сервера
Перед установкой Bitrix Virtual Appliance на новый сервер необходимо выполнить некоторые предварительные настройки. Сначала убедитесь, что сервер соответствует требованиям Bitrix Virtual Appliance. Для этого проверьте версию ОС, наличие необходимых пакетов и доступные ресурсы.
Далее установите необходимые пакеты и настройте сеть. Важно также настроить доступ SSH, чтобы можно было удаленно управлять сервером.
Шаг 2: Загрузка и установка Bitrix Virtual Appliance
Bitrix Virtual Appliance – готовая виртуальная машина, которая содержит в себе все необходимые компоненты для работы Bitrix CMS. Скачайте образ Bitrix Virtual Appliance с официального сайта Bitrix и загрузите его на новый сервер.
После загрузки образа необходимо установить Bitrix Virtual Appliance с помощью гипервизора. Для этого создайте новую виртуальную машину и выберите загруженный образ в качестве основы.
Шаг 3: Настройка Bitrix Virtual Appliance
После установки Bitrix Virtual Appliance необходимо выполнить настройку для запуска Bitrix CMS. Войдите в виртуальную машину через SSH и выполните необходимые настройки с помощью утилиты bxsetup.
Настройки могут включать в себя выбор языка, установку базы данных, установку сертификата SSL и другие параметры.
В результате успешной установки Bitrix Virtual Appliance на новый сервер вы сможете перенести базу данных и продолжить работу с Bitrix CMS.
Копирование бэкапа на новый сервер
При переносе базы Битрикс на новый сервер необходимо сделать бэкап базы данных и скопировать его на новый сервер.
Для копирования бэкапа на новый сервер можно использовать различные методы, такие как FTP, SSH или средства панели управления хостингом.
Также важно убедиться, что на новом сервере установлен тот же самый движок Битрикс и его версия соответствует версии базы данных.
После копирования бэкапа на новый сервер необходимо выполнить процедуру восстановления базы данных в соответствии с инструкцией производителя.
После успешного восстановления базы данных на новом сервере можно приступать к настройке сайта на новом хостинге.
Восстановление базы данных на новом сервере
Шаг 1: Создание новой базы данных на сервере
Перед тем как восстанавливать базу данных, необходимо создать новую базу данных на новом сервере. Для этого нужно зайти в панель управления хостингом и выбрать раздел «Базы данных». Затем следует выбрать опцию «Создать новую базу данных» и указать имя базы данных, логин, пароль для подключения к базе данных.
Шаг 2: Создание резервной копии базы данных на старом сервере
Далее необходимо создать резервную копию базы данных на старом сервере. Для этого нужно зайти в административную панель Битрикса и выбрать раздел «Настройки». Затем следует выбрать опцию «Резервное копирование» и нажать на кнопку «Создать резервную копию».
Шаг 3: Перенос базы данных на новый сервер
После того, как резервная копия базы данных будет создана, можно начинать перенос базы данных на новый сервер. Для этого нужно скопировать файл с резервной копией базы данных на новый сервер и загрузить его в директорию «/bitrix/backup/» на новом сервере. Затем нужно зайти в административную панель Битрикса на новом сервере и выбрать раздел «Настройки». Затем следует выбрать опцию «Резервное копирование» и нажать на кнопку «Восстановить базу данных».
Шаг 4: Перенастройка подключения к базе данных
После того, как база данных будет восстановлена на новом сервере, необходимо перенастроить подключение к базе данных. Для этого нужно зайти в файл «/bitrix/php_interface/dbconn.php» на новом сервере и изменить параметры подключения к базе данных на новые.
Проверка работоспособности перенесенной БД
После переноса базы данных Битрикс необходимо проверить её работоспособность, чтобы убедиться в корректности переноса. Для этого можно использовать несколько методов.
- Первым шагом необходимо проверить, что все функциональные возможности, доступные на предыдущем сервере, работают на новом сервере. Например, это могут быть функции импорта и экспорта данных, работа с файлами, отправка уведомлений, создание заказов и т.д.
- Далее необходимо проверить, что данные в базе были успешно перенесены. Например, проверить, что все пользователи, заказы, товары и другие данные актуальны и не пострадали в процессе переноса.
- Также необходимо убедиться, что данные корректно отображаются на сайте. Для этого можно пройти по различным страницам сайта и убедиться, что все данные отображаются корректно.
- Еще одним важным шагом является проверка скорости загрузки сайта после переноса базы данных на новый сервер. Если скорость загрузки сильно ухудшилась, необходимо выявить причины и попытаться их устранить.
В случае обнаружения каких-либо проблем после переноса базы данных необходимо провести дополнительные мероприятия для устранения этих проблем и повышения стабильности работы сайта.
Вопрос-ответ:
Какой способ переноса базы данных Битрикса является наиболее безопасным?
Наиболее безопасный способ переноса базы данных Битрикса — это резервирование базы данных и затем использование этого резервного копирования для восстановления на новом сервере.
Можно ли перенести базу данных Битрикса на другой сервер с помощью программного обеспечения?
Да, можно использовать программное обеспечение, такое как phpMyAdmin, для экспорта и импорта базы данных Битрикса на другой сервер.
Можно ли перенести базу данных Битрикса в облако?
Да, можно перенести базу данных Битрикса в облако, используя специализированные сервисы, такие как Amazon Web Services или Microsoft Azure.
Какие параметры сервера нужно учитывать при переносе базы данных Битрикса?
При переносе базы данных Битрикса необходимо учитывать параметры сервера, такие как операционная система, версия MySQL, настройки конфигурации PHP и доступные ресурсы сервера.
Можно ли перенести только определенные таблицы из базы данных Битрикса?
Да, можно перенести только определенные таблицы из базы данных Битрикса, используя программное обеспечение, поддерживающее экспорт и импорт конкретных таблиц.